My hypothesis:
- On Feb 28, booking can be made up to Jan 28 the next year.
- On March 1, booking opens up for Feb 1 the next year.
- Crux of my hypothesis: the date checker checks what is 11m from [today], we'll call that [Gated Until 8am Date] then compares if [reservation start date] is less than [Gated Until 8am Date]
- If [reservation start date] is less than [Gated Until 8am Date], then allow booking
- If the above were true, then on Mar 1 between midnight and 8am ET, it would be possible to make a reservation with [reservation start date] of Jan 29, 30, or 31st.
Alas, it didn't work.
Testing results:
It looks like they do show the 'Wait until 8am ET' error based on the logic in my hypothesis (!), but there is another mechanism that blocks Jan 29-31 from being booked.
- Booking a reservation with start date of Feb 1:
- 'Wait until 8am ET' error
- Booking a reservation with start date of Jan 31:
- 'Unexpected error occurred' type of error
- Booking a reservation with start date of Jan 30:
- 'Unexpected error occurred' type of error
- Booking a reservation with start date of Jan 29:
- Didn't test
